What is Dutasteride used for?
Dutasteride is a recently approved drug developed by GlaxoSmithKline. Dutasteride is a dual 5-alpha-reductase inhibitor that is indicated for the treatment of symptomatic benign prostatic hyperplasia (BPH) in men with an enlarged prostate to:
- Improve symptoms
- Reduce the risk of acute urinary retention
- Reduce the risk of the need for BPH-related surgery
Dutasteride is currently in trial phase for the treatment of alopecia (hairloss).
How does Dutasteride Work?
Prostate growth is caused by a hormone in the blood called dihydrotestosterone (DHT). Dutasteride lowers DHT production in the body, leading to shrinkage of the enlarged prostate in most men. Just as your prostate became large over a long period of time, reducing the size of your prostate and improving your symptoms will take time. While some men have fewer problems and symptoms after 3 months of treatment with Dutasteride, a treatment period of at least 6 months is usually necessary to see if Dutasteride will work for you. Studies have shown that treatment with Dutasteride for 2 years reduces the risk of complete blockage of urine flow (acute urinary retention) and/or the need for surgery for benign prostatic hyperplasia (BPH).
Dutasteride is an FDA-Approved Drug
- Avodart™ FDA New Drug Application Number 21-319/S-001: 10-9-2002 Avodart ™ (Dutasteride 0.5mg) soft-gelatin capsules.
- FDA New Drug Application Number 21-319: Approved 11-20-2001 for treatment of Benign Prostatic Hyperplasia (BPH).
- Approvals in other markets are pending.
Dutasteride and Hairloss
Dutasteride is being developed for the treatment of Male Pattern Baldness (MPB). Dutasteride, which is taken in capsule form, has shown dramatic success in restoring hair to bald men in trials. It interferes with 5-alpha-reductase enzymes that break down the male hormone testosterone and turn it into dehydrotestosterone (DHT) - which causes hair to thin dramatically in later life. Dutasteride is has better DHT supression results than finasteride both Propecia and Proscar).

Other Names for Dutasteride
Prior to deciding on Avodart™ as the marketing name for Dutasteride, several other names were discussed such as Duagen and Avolve. In addition, there are numerous versions of generic dutasteride, the most popular of which are Dutas, Duprost and Dutagen.
